Olympic gold medals are mainly made from silver…
'According to International Olympic Committee regulations, Olympic gold and silver medals must be made out of at least 92.5% silver, with gold medals plated with at least 6g of gold. Bronze medals are made mostly of copper.
Each medal must be at least 60mm diameter and 3mm thick, but each country’s organising committee is able to create their own bespoke design. They also feature a ribbon which is designed by the organising committee.’
